The Directorate of Technical Education, Maharashtra, has declared the results of the 2018 Common Entrance Test (MHT-CET) late on Saturday. Kadam Abhijit Uddhavrao topped the Physics Chemistry Biology (PCB) category by scoring 188 out of 200, while Abhang Aditya Subhash secured 195 marks to top the Physics, Chemistry and Maths (PCM) category. Abhang have also stood first in reserved category in PCM. Another student from reserved category who stood first in PCB is Prashant Wayal with score 182 out of 200.

Among girls, Mona Gandhi topped the PCM category with 189 marks and Jahnvi Mokashi topped the PCB catergory with 183 marks. More than 4.19 lakh students appeared for the Maharashtra CET for engineering admission on May 10. Students will get their results on Sunday.

Over 4.35 lakh students registered for the exam and more than 4.19 lakh appeared for the test.

After discrepancies in the maths and chemistry papers, five marks as bonus were given to all students. Around 257 students scored between 176 and 200 in the test in the PCM category and 277 scored between 176 and 200 in PCB category. The number of students scoring more then 100 marks is 16,548 in the PCB category. In the PCM category, 22,844 students scored 100 and more.
